Happy Birthday To Me

Touille begging
Touille begging by MBK.

I don't really know the exact date of my birth, but MB has chosen May 17 to celebrate my birthday. Of course the day was really just like any other. When a dog gets to be 16 years old, that's a pretty good span of life. A good day to me is when I get plenty of treats and a good walk.

According to WebMD's chart, a 14 year old small dog is equivalent to a human aged 72. MB is only 52, but sometimes she acts like she's a lot older than I am. This morning on our walk, a neighbor looked at us moving along and called me "Little Feisty." I am sure he thought that MB was old and decrepit by comparison.
MB chose to spend the day at her "job" and then doing some laundry. We didn't even have time for a long walk afterwards, but MB promises that today will be a good day to explore the entire neighborhood (after she comes home from doing whatever it is that she does for most of the daylight hours).
I plan to take many naps until she returns.


- Touille, a dog who has seen many sunrises and sunsets, and who hopes to see many more
